Punjab Announces Winter Vacation Schedule for 2025–26 – Schools to Close from Dec 23

The Punjab School Education Department (PSED) recently announced that all public and private schools across the province will observe winter vacation from 23 December 2025 to 10 January 2026, with classes resuming on 13 January 2026.

Winter Vacation Schedule for 2025–26 

OccasionDate
Start of Winter Vacation23 December 2025 (Tuesday)
End of Winter Vacation10 January 2026 (Saturday)
Schools Reopen13 January 2026 (Monday)

Why This Break Matters

Late December is often cold, foggy, and smoggy in Punjab. The authorities decided to give this break to protect students from hazardous weather—cold waves, dense fog, and polluted air that can affect early-morning commutes and children’s health.  Additionally, the synchronized timetable helps families plan holidays, home visits, and other activities with clarity. It also ensures that all schools follow the same academic calendar without confusion.
